Output 374a30c831d06a7cc267ad3925a97f777096cd30c19abf87612308f8ab37891e:23

value
950864
script pubkey
OP_0 OP_PUSHBYTES_20 50ef3c35e56ea23b0c7e30c987d99e1ef25effcc
address
bc1q2rhncd09d63rkrr7xryc0kv7rme9al7vjdzmns
transaction
374a30c831d06a7cc267ad3925a97f777096cd30c19abf87612308f8ab37891e